Aim, press the trigger, allow the pistol to reset in recoil, and fire again. IN fact, most hits were in the X-ring with a few in the 8 and 9 rings. Firing at man-sized targets at 5 and 7 yards, the Spectre proved effective in taking out the X-ring. The grip treatment and trigger combined to give the shooter excellent control in firing strings. The pistol isn’t as comfortable to fire as a SIG P320, but recoil wasn’t sharp or painful. This is a 21-ounce pistol, so there is recoil energy. The pistol never failed to feed, chamber, fire, or eject. Most of the ammunition used was Fiocchi FMJ in 124-grain, Federal American Eagle 124-grain, and Federal Syntech 9mm. At the Rangeįiring the pistol was a pleasure. The SIG Romeo offers easy windage and elevation adjustments. The trigger guard is slightly elongated compared to the SIG P365. The grip treatment includes recesses in the grip that give the shooter greater purchase than the standard P365 did. Once you have affirmed the grip, the pistol isn’t going anywhere whether the hand is wet, cold, or sweaty. Grip texture provides what most of us will find to be an ideal balance of adhesion and abrasion. The grip tang is extended for better feel and recoil control. While the slide catches the eye, the polymer receiver holding the stainless-steel chassis has also received special treatment. I think releasing the slide after a reload by wedging the rear sight on a belt or boot heel is viable with this setup. If the need arises, you may rack the slide by using the wedge-type rear sight. Radioactive tritium makes for true 24-hour sighting ability. These sights feature a fluorescent circle around the bright front sight and two dots in the rear sight. The slide features excellent machine work and a battle worn finish.
